nineteen forties: Cathode Ray Tube Amusement Gadget

This is considered (with official documentation) as the 1st electronic sport gadget ever made. It was designed by Thomas T. Goldsmith Jr. and Estle Ray Mann. The match was assembled in the forties and submitted for an US Patent in January 1947. The patent was granted December 1948, which also helps make it the very first electronic sport system to ever get a patent (US Patent 2,455,992). As described in the patent, it was an analog circuit device with an array of knobs utilized to move a dot that appeared in the cathode ray tube exhibit. This recreation was motivated by how missiles appeared in WWII radars, and the object of the sport was merely managing a “missile” in order to hit a goal. In the forties it was incredibly hard (for not stating unattainable) to present graphics in a Cathode Ray Tube exhibit. Simply because of this, only the true “missile” appeared on the show. The concentrate on and any other graphics ended up showed on monitor overlays manually positioned on the show monitor. It truly is been mentioned by numerous that Atari’s renowned video game “Missile Command” was developed after this gaming system.

1951: NIMROD

NIMROD was the title of a electronic pc gadget from the 50s decade. The creators of this personal computer have been the engineers of an British isles-primarily based company below the identify Ferranti, with the concept of exhibiting the gadget at the 1951 Festival of Britain (and later on it was also confirmed in Berlin).

NIM is a two-player numerical game of method, which is considered to arrive at first from the historical China. The principles of NIM are effortless: There are a particular variety of teams (or “heaps”), and every single group is made up of a particular number of objects (a common starting up array of NIM is three heaps containing three, 4, and 5 objects respectively). Every single participant get turns removing objects from the heaps, but all taken out objects need to be from a single heap and at the very least one item is removed. The participant to consider the last object from the very last heap loses, however there is a variation of the recreation in which the participant to get the very last item of the previous heap wins.

NIMROD utilised a lights panel as a show and was planned and created with the exclusive goal of playing the match of NIM, which tends to make it the initial electronic laptop system to be exclusively produced for enjoying a game (however the major notion was demonstrating and illustrating how a electronic computer functions, rather than to entertain and have fun with it). Simply because it isn’t going to have “raster movie products” as a show (a Tv set, check, and so forth.) it is not regarded as by many men and women as a genuine “video clip game” (an digital match, of course… a video clip sport, no…). But after once more, it genuinely relies upon on your stage of check out when you speak about a “movie match”.

1952: OXO (“Noughts and Crosses”)

This was a digital variation of “Tic-Tac-Toe”, designed for an EDSAC (Digital Delay Storage Automatic Calculator) pc. It was created by Alexander S. Douglas from the College of Cambridge, and a single more time it was not made for entertainment, it was component of his PhD Thesis on “Interactions in between human and laptop”.

The guidelines of the sport are these of a normal Tic-Tac-Toe recreation, player in opposition to the personal computer (no two-participant alternative was accessible). The input strategy was a rotary dial (like the kinds in aged telephones). 1958: Tennis for Two

“Tennis for Two” was produced by William Higinbotham, a physicist working at the Brookhaven Countrywide Laboratory. This recreation was created as a way of enjoyment, so laboratory site visitors had anything funny to do for the duration of their wait around on “site visitors day” (finally!… a video game that was created “just for entertaining”…) . The game was quite properly made for its era: the ball habits was modified by many variables like gravity, wind velocity, situation and angle of contact, and many others. you had to keep away from the net as in genuine tennis, and several other things. The video clip sport components included two “joysticks” (two controllers with a rotational knob and a push button every) connected to an analog console, and an oscilloscope as a screen.

“Tennis for Two” is deemed by a lot of the 1st video clip sport at any time designed. But after once more, many other folks differ from that thought stating that “it was a laptop game, not a movie recreation” or “the output show was an oscilloscope, not a “raster” online video display… so it does not qualify as a video clip match”. But well… you are unable to remember to everyone…

It is also rumored that “Tennis for Two” was the inspiration for Atari’s mega strike “Pong”, but this rumor has often been strongly denied… for obvious motives.

1961: Spacewar!

“Spacewar!” video recreation was developed by Stephen Russell, with the assist of J. Martin Graetz, Peter Samson, Alan Kotok, Wayne Witanen and Dan Edwards from MIT. By the nineteen sixties, MIT was “the proper option” if you needed to do computer study and growth. So this fifty percent a dozen of progressive fellas took advantage of a brand-new personal computer was requested and anticipated to get there campus quite quickly (a DEC PDP-one) and commenced considering about what variety of components testing programs would be created. When they found out that a “Precision CRT Display” would be set up to the method, they instantly made a decision that “some form of visual/interactive game” would be the demonstration software program of option for the PDP-one. And following some discussion, it was quickly made a decision to be a space struggle match or some thing related. After this choice, all other suggestions arrived out pretty rapid: like principles of the recreation, planning ideas, programming suggestions, and so forth.

So right after about two hundred man/hrs of work, the first version of the sport was at final all set to be tested. The sport consisted of two spaceships (affectively named by players “pencil” and “wedge”) shooting missiles at every other with a star in the middle of the display (which “pulls” the two spaceships simply because of its gravitational drive). A established of management switches was used to management every single spaceship (for rotation, pace, missiles, and “hyperspace”). Every single spaceship have a minimal quantity of gas and weapons, and the hyperspace choice was like a “worry button”, in case there is no other way out (it could possibly “preserve you or split you”).

The computer match was an immediate success in between MIT pupils and programmers, and soon they commenced creating their possess adjustments to the sport program (like actual star charts for track record, star/no star choice, history disable alternative, angular momentum selection, amid other people). The sport code was ported to many other computer platforms (since the recreation needed a online video screen, a tough to uncover option in 1960s methods, it was mainly ported to more recent/more affordable DEC methods like the PDP-10 and PDP-11).

Spacewar! is not only regarded by many as the 1st “real” video recreation (given that this recreation does have a online video display), but it also have been proved to be the accurate predecessor of the original arcade match, as effectively as being the inspiration of several other movie game titles, consoles, and even video clip gaming firms (can you say “Atari”?…).
